Output 3bec7e0c99c516a296852c7e9d01cc2497f524038f3f62faea19e9234ce462b5:0

value
65000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d95ec29bc833ca211de1103a3e049dc88e947c9 OP_EQUALVERIFY OP_CHECKSIG
address
19XqSe4VtMpbdUFDG8pQnKYpwExfxvk2mH
transaction
3bec7e0c99c516a296852c7e9d01cc2497f524038f3f62faea19e9234ce462b5
spent
true